Properly cleaning a knee brace requires identifying specific textile and rigid components to prevent material degradation, bacterial accumulation, and skin irritation. By following a structured hand-washing protocol with mild antibacterial agents and avoiding machine tumbling, you preserve the structural integrity of your medical-grade or athletic support while ensuring absolute dermatological safety.

Pre-Cleaning Preparation and Equipment Checklist

Maintaining orthotic and athletic support devices requires careful planning to prevent structural warping, metal rust, and the breakdown of elastic neoprene or breath-mesh fabrics. Before initiating the cleaning process, you must assemble the correct cleaning agents and understand your device's exact material composition. Failure to verify wash labels can result in delamination of laminated fabrics or the loss of compression integrity in specialized weaves.



  • Essential Cleaning Materials: Mild hypoallergenic liquid detergent or antibacterial dish soap, a clean soft-bristled toothbrush, clean white microfiber towels, a basin or sink with temperature-regulated running water, and specialized odor-neutralizing textile sprays if permitted by the manufacturer.
  • Prerequisites and Standards: Remove all detachable metal hinges, silicone gel buttresses, and rigid polyethylene or carbon-fiber shells before submerging textile sleeves. Verify whether the device features hook-and-loop (Velcro) fasteners that require lint removal to maintain adhesive strength.
  • Time and Budget Benchmarks: Total active maintenance takes approximately 10 to 15 minutes, followed by an air-drying window of 12 to 24 hours. The financial investment is negligible, requiring only standard household laundering supplies costing less than two dollars per wash cycle.

Step-by-Step Knee Brace Sanitization and Washing Workflow



Step 1: Disassembly and Hardware Extraction

Begin by carefully inspecting the orthosis and detaching all removable components. Slide aluminum or stainless steel hinges out of their designated side pockets, and pull out any removable silicone patellar rings or gel pads. Fasten all hook-and-loop (Velcro) straps to themselves; this prevents the abrasive hooks from snagging the compression fabric or collecting lint during the cleaning cycle.

Warning: Never submerge mechanical geared hinges or carbon-fiber structural frames in water unless explicitly rated as fully waterproof by the manufacturer, as trapped moisture inside sealed hinge tracks can cause internal corrosion.



Step 2: Surface Debris and Lint Removal

Inspect the interior lining for accumulated skin cells, sweat salt crusts, and loose lint trapped within the Velcro anchoring zones. Use a dry, soft-bristled toothbrush or a specialized lint roller to gently brush away surface particulate matter from the fabric weave and strap matrices. Clearing this debris prevents it from turning into a muddy paste once water is introduced.



Step 3: Gentle Submersion and Surfactant Application

Fill a clean basin with lukewarm water—never hot water, as elevated temperatures degrade elastane, spandex, and neoprene elasticity. Add a teaspoon of mild, dye-free, and fragrance-free liquid detergent or antibacterial hand soap, agitating the water to create a light sudsy solution. Submerge the fabric sleeve or strap assembly and gently knead the material with your hands to allow the surfactant to penetrate deep into the woven fibers where sweat-eating bacteria thrive.

Pro-Tip: For stubborn, deep-set odors caused by prolonged athletic use, add a few drops of white vinegar to your wash basin during the soaking phase to naturally neutralize bacterial metabolic byproducts without harming synthetic technical fabrics.



Step 4: Targeted Scrubbing and Rinsing

Pay specialized attention to high-contact zones such as the popliteal (back of the knee) region and interior silicone grip strips, which accumulate the highest concentration of sebum and sweat. Dip your soft-bristled toothbrush into the soapy water and gently scrub these areas using circular motions. Drain the soapy water, refill the basin with clean cold water, and thoroughly rinse the brace until all soap residue is completely eliminated to prevent skin rashes.



Step 5: Controlled Air-Drying Procedure

Press the wet brace firmly between two clean microfiber towels to extract excess moisture, taking care not to wring, twist, or stretch the fabric. Lay the brace flat on a dry towel in a well-ventilated area away from direct sunlight, heating vents, or clothes dryers. High thermal exposure will permanently warp rigid plastic shells and melt the elastic memory of compression sleeves.

Knee Brace Material Matrix and Maintenance Parameters



Brace Component Primary Material Cleaning Method Drying Protocol Common Vulnerability
Neoprene Sleeve Chloroprene Rubber, Nylon Hand wash, mild soap Air dry flat, shade Heat warping, loss of stretch
Hinged Post-Op Brace Aluminum, Foam Padding Wipe metal, hand wash pads Air dry vertically Hinge rust, foam degradation
Rigid Osteoarthritis Brace Carbon Fiber, Titanium Damp cloth wipe down Air dry completely Delamination, paint scratching
Ligament Sport Support Spandex, Silicone, Mesh Gentle hand soak Air dry flat Velcro wear, lint accumulation

Troubleshooting Common Cleaning and Maintenance Issues



  • Root Cause: Persistent mildew or sour odors remain trapped inside the neoprene core even after standard washing. Actionable Fix: Submerge the dry fabric sleeve in a solution of one part white vinegar to four parts cold water for thirty minutes, rinse thoroughly with fresh water, and let it dry outdoors in a shaded, breezy location.
  • Root Cause: Hook-and-loop (Velcro) fasteners lose their grip strength and continuously peel open during physical activity. Actionable Fix: Use the tine of a clean fork or a fine-toothed pet comb to meticulously rake out accumulated lint, threads, and hair fibers trapped inside the hook matrix, restoring full mechanical adhesion.
  • Root Cause: Metal hinges squeak or grind during flexion and extension following a wash cycle. Actionable Fix: Ensure the hinges are 100 percent dry, then apply a tiny drop of medical-grade silicone lubricant or specialized dry-film teflon spray directly to the pivot point, wiping away any excess residue.
  • Root Cause: Skin irritation, redness, or contact dermatitis develops immediately after wearing a freshly cleaned brace. Actionable Fix: The cleaning agent was insufficiently rinsed out; re-submerge the entire soft brace in clean water for fifteen minutes, knead thoroughly, and air dry to eliminate residual surfactant chemicals.

Frequently Asked Questions



Can I put my knee brace in the washing machine?

You should generally avoid putting a knee brace in a washing machine unless the manufacturer explicitly states it is machine-washable in the user manual. Machine agitation, spin cycles, and tumbling heat can violently warp rigid stays, rust mechanical metal hinges, and destroy the delicate elastane fibers that provide structural compression.



How often should I wash my knee brace?

If you wear your knee brace daily for athletic activities or intense rehabilitation, you should wash the soft textile components at least once or twice a week. For intermittent wear or post-operative bracing worn over clothing, cleaning every one to two weeks is typically sufficient to manage bacterial growth and odor.



What is the best way to eliminate stubborn sweat smells from neoprene braces?

Neoprene is a closed-cell rubber foam that absorbs body oils and harbors odor-causing bacteria deep within its pores. Soaking the brace in a mixture of cold water and white vinegar, or utilizing a specialized athletic enzymatic wash formulated for wetsuits, safely neutralizes these smells without damaging the rubber matrix.



Is it safe to use bleach or fabric softener on my knee brace?

Never use chlorine bleach, harsh chemical solvents, or fabric softeners when cleaning your orthotic device. Bleach degrades synthetic polymers and corrodes aluminum hinges, while fabric softeners leave a chemical coating on technical moisture-wicking fabrics that clogs the weave and ruins breathability.



How long does a properly cleaned knee brace take to dry completely?

Depending on ambient humidity and room temperature, a disassembled knee brace typically requires between 12 and 24 hours to air dry completely. Always ensure the device is 100 percent dry before reinserting metal hinges or wearing it to prevent moisture-trapping skin maceration.
